The Next Evolution of Tesla’s Optimus
The new Optimus prototype showcases remarkable advancements compared to previous versions. Designed to function in everyday environments, this AI-powered humanoid robot demonstrates improved movement, balance, and dexterity—further closing the gap between concept and practical deployment.
Key features of the new Optimus include:
-
Enhanced joint articulation and walking stability
-
Improved hand control for object manipulation
-
Onboard Tesla AI hardware for autonomous decision-making
-
Energy-efficient design for long-duration tasks
-
Human-like proportions for seamless interaction in shared spaces
From Factory Floors to Real-World Use
According to Musk, Optimus is intended not just for Tesla factories, but also for real-world applications such as:
-
Home assistance and elder care
-
Dangerous or repetitive industrial work
-
Retail and logistics
-
Future roles in colonizing Mars
Tesla’s vision is to produce millions of these robots, significantly lowering labor costs while improving safety and efficiency across industries.
Why This Robot Stands Out
What makes this unveiling truly stunning is the rapid pace of development. In less than two years since the first public announcement, Tesla has shifted from a theoretical concept to a functional prototype capable of walking, performing tasks, and processing real-time data through neural networks.
Unlike other humanoid robots that focus primarily on form, Tesla is integrating real-world AI with robotics to create a platform that learns, adapts, and scales—similar to the approach used in Tesla’s Full Self-Driving (FSD) software.
